Transaction 986642bc2be995908c281733ebf2c268b52e8bb69e7a0837028a9bbefee107d2
1 Input
1 Output
-
986642bc2be995908c281733ebf2c268b52e8bb69e7a0837028a9bbefee107d2:0
- value
- 99987684
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4615a83dcac44d9c2f249c82a1236043685887ea OP_EQUAL
- address
- 385bAjshGyG3z6DwQjxYE2AvDAQkqpoqGy